Frequently Asked Questions
Common questions about SignContract for WooCommerce
Yes. The plugin connects WooCommerce to the SignContract service. A SignContract account and active plan are required to create signing sessions.
Yes. When you connect your store, you can start a 7-day trial with 5 signed approvals included. No credit card is required. After the trial, choose a paid plan to continue signing.
Yes. This plugin is designed for WooCommerce stores.
The WordPress plugin can be installed, but signing sessions and SaaS features require a SignContract account or subscription. A 7-day trial with a 5-document trial allowance is available at no cost and does not require a payment method.
Once the 7-day trial period ends or all 5 signed approvals have been used, new signing sessions cannot be created. Existing signed documents and template configurations remain visible. Choose a paid plan in the WooCommerce SignContract settings to continue signing.
Disabling the integration stops new signing sessions from being created. Existing signing links remain valid until their normal expiry, and historical signed records remain visible.
No. Disabling the integration prevents new signing requests but does not invalidate existing signing links.
The merchant can configure pending signing link expiry from 1 to 168 hours. The maximum is 168 hours, which is 7 days.
No. Signing link expiry controls how long a pending customer signing link can be used. Signed PDF download availability and retention are controlled by the merchant's SignContract plan after the document is signed.
Yes. Templates can be assigned to products or categories. Product-specific templates take priority, then category templates, then the fallback template.
